Comprehending the DVLA Online Driving Licence Services
The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ency operates as an executive agency of the Department for Transport, responsible for preserving the database of motorists and vehicles in the United Kingdom. Their online platform, accessible through the official Gov.UK Driving License site, provides a comprehensive suite of services that have changed how vehicle drivers interact with driver licencing authorities.
The online system manages numerous distinct categories of driving licence services. New chauffeurs can look for their first provisional licence, which permits learning to drive under certain conditions. Existing licence holders can restore their licences when they approach the ten-year expiration date on the photocard. Those who have actually lost or damaged their licences can request replacements, while any licence holder can upgrade their name, address, or other individual details through the self-service portal.
The introduction of the photocard driving licence in 1998 marked the start of the digital change in driver administration. This credit-card-sized identification document consisting of a photo and individual information showed essential for the advancement of online services. The DVLA has actually progressively broadened its digital offerings, with the bulk of routine licence transactions now capable of completion online. This shift has proved particularly important for the countless people who depend on their driving licences not only for driving however also as a main form of identification.
Advantages of Applying for Your Driving Licence Online
The advantages of utilizing the online driving licence service extend far beyond mere benefit. Applicants who pick the digital path experience considerably quicker processing times compared to postal applications. While postal applications may require several weeks for processing and delivery, online applications for services such as licence renewals and replacements often process within days and even hours in many cases.
The online system likewise decreases the possibility of errors that can delay applications. The digital kinds consist of recognition checks that flag missing information or inconsistencies before submission, making sure that applications are total when gotten by the DVLA. This instant feedback removes the frustrating experience of getting an application back in the post with an ask for extra information.
Availability shows another significant benefit of the online service. The Gov.uk website runs twenty-four hours a day, seven days a week, allowing users to finish applications sometimes that suit their schedules. This versatility shows particularly valuable for working individuals who may discover it challenging to go to a Post Office branch or DVLA office during basic organization hours. In addition, the digital application procedure is eco-friendly, removing the need for paper applications and lowering postal transport.
Step-by-Step Process for Online Applications
The application process for a UK driving licence online follows a structured technique designed to assist users through each stage methodically. Before starting an application, users should ensure they have all required paperwork and information easily available, consisting of valid identity documents, a suitable digital photo if needed, and payment information for any appropriate charges.
The primary step includes checking out the main Gov.uk site and browsing to the driving licence section. Users exist with plainly identified alternatives corresponding to their particular needs, whether requesting a provisionary licence, restoring an existing licence, or requesting a replacement. Each option leads to a tailored application path with appropriate questions and requirements.
The application itself needs candidates to verify their identity through a series of security questions, typically drawing on info from credit records or other main databases. This identity verification procedure helps secure against fraudulent applications while enhancing the experience for legitimate applicants. Following identity confirmation, users proceed through screens requesting individual information, driving history details, and appropriate statements. The system provides details in digestible sections, permitting users to examine and customize entries before last submission.
Payment for appropriate charges occurs through a protected online payment system, with major credit and debit cards accepted. Upon successful submission and payment, candidates receive a reference number that enables them to track the development of their application online. The DVLA then processes the application, with verification of the result and the new licence posted to the candidate's registered address.

Necessary Information for Applicants
Before starting an online driving licence application, specific preparations simplify the process significantly. Having the appropriate paperwork and info prepared prevents hold-ups and lowers the danger of application rejection.
Applicants need to possess a valid UK residency status and have the ability to offer appropriate identity documentation. This usually consists of a present UK passport, a recent biometric house permit, or another government-issued identity file. For first-time candidates without a passport, alternative identity verification techniques are readily available but may require additional documentation.
Those getting their first provisional licence should also have passed the driving theory test before starting the application procedure. The theory test certificate remains legitimate for two years, meaning candidates must pass the useful driving test within this timeframe or retake the theory test.
An ideal digital picture is needed for most online applications, except when the DVLA can utilize an existing passport photograph from their records. Digital photos need to satisfy specific requirements relating to size, structure, and image quality, with comprehensive assistance readily available on the Gov.uk site to help candidates capture acceptable images.
Frequently Asked Questions
How do I find my driving licence number for online services?
Your driving licence number can be discovered on the front of your photocard licence, placed in a particular format that includes letters and numbers. The number normally includes the very first 5 characters of your surname followed by numbers and letters representing your date of birth and other identifying info. If you can not locate your physical licence, you can still access some services using your National Insurance number and personal details to validate your identity.
Can I drive while awaiting my online licence application to process?
If you are renewing an existing licence and submitted your application before the expiry date, you might continue driving while awaiting your brand-new licence, supplied you are not disqualified and meet all other licensing requirements. Nevertheless, you should bring your old licence and any correspondence from the DVLA to demonstrate that your application is pending if questioned by authorities. For newbie applicants or those whose licences have ended, driving is not permitted up until the new licence is received.
What should I do if my online application is declined?
If your online application is turned down, the DVLA will send you a letter discussing the reason for the rejection. Typical factors consist of identity verification failures, exceptional disqualifications, or medical conditions needing additional evaluation. Most of the times, you can resolve the issue by providing extra paperwork or information. The rejection letter will define precisely what is needed and whether you need to resubmit your application through a various channel.
Is the DVLA online service protect for personal details?
The Gov.uk online driving licence service uses industry-standard security measures to protect individual information sent through the platform. All information is encrypted throughout transmission, and the service runs under stringent government data protection policies. The DVLA will never ever request your full banking information, National Insurance number, or other delicate information through unsolicited e-mails or telephone call. Users must guarantee they are accessing the official Gov.uk site by confirming the web address before getting in personal info.
